Meet my great grandmother, Mrs. Mary Ella Williams, born April 9, 1874, three years before the end of Reconstruction, and one year before Blanche K. Bruce, an African American, was elected to the U. S. Senate, serving from 1875-1881. She died February 2, 1936. She was the third daughter of parents born free in 1850s Virginia and Georgia.
